Abstract

In this paper, a two-port wideband MIMO antenna for n77/n78/n79/5GHz WiFi sub-6GHz 5G applications is presented. The MIMO antenna structure is composed the two symmetrical circular slot monopole antennas with a common ground plane and an overall antenna size FR4 of 36×18×1.6 mm 3 . A T-shaped ground stub is placed between the two radiating patches in the ground plane to achieve impedance bandwidth (3.3GHz- 6GHz) and high isolation to reduce the mutual coupling effect between MIMO antenna elements. The proposed MIMO antenna has a low mutual coupling of (S 21 9.9), MEG gain of –3dB, and a peak gain of 2.1 by utilizing CST software. It is observed that a two-port MIMO antenna is suitable for sub-6GHz 5G and IoT applications.
